
The developers at Larian Studios continue their active support for the critically acclaimed cRPG Baldur’s Gate 3. In March, the 36th hotfix was released, bringing with it a series of important technical improvements.
This minor yet significant update focuses on fixing critical bugs and improving game stability. Notably, a bug on Xbox consoles was resolved, which previously caused incorrect display of tooltips in the inventory and trade screens, thereby significantly enhancing the user experience.
Among other crucial fixes, the update addresses issues with frame rate drops and subsequent game crashes when attempting to load saved sessions. This fix is expected to significantly boost overall game performance and reliability.
Mac users also received an important correction: they can now seamlessly continue their game after character creation, even when selecting the maximum difficulty level, a scenario that previously led to a crash.
